In a striking contrast to Universal Music's approach, Warner has partnered with popular video sharing site YouTube to provide access to its catalogue of music videos.

Under the agreement, YouTube users will have full access to videos from Warner artists. They will also be permitted incorporate material from those videos into their own clips, which can then be uploaded to the service. Warner and YouTube will share advertising revenue sold in connection with the video content.
